11 * Libunwind implementation for the model-checker
13 * Libunwind provides an pluggable stack unwinding API: the way the current
14 * registers and memory is accessed, the way unwinding informations is found
17 * This component implements the libunwind API for he model-checker:
19 * * reading memory from a simgrid::mc::AddressSpace*;
21 * * reading stack registers from a saved snapshot (context).
23 * Parts of the libunwind information fetching is currently handled by the
24 * standard `libunwind` implementations (either the local one or the ptrace one)
25 * because parsing `.eh_frame` section is not fun and `libdw` does not help

39 /** Virtual table for our `libunwind-process_vm_readv` implementation.
41 * This implementation reuse most the code of `libunwind-ptrace` but
42 * does not use ptrace() to read the target process memory by
43 * `process_vm_readv()` or `/dev/${pid}/mem` if possible.
45 * Does not support any MC-specific behaviour (privatisation, snapshots)
48 * It works with `void*` contexts allocated with `_UPT_create(pid)`.
50 extern XBT_PRIVATE unw_accessors_t mc_unw_vmread_accessors;
52 /** Virtual table for our `libunwind` implementation
54 * Stack unwinding on a `simgrid::mc::Process*` (for memory, unwinding information)
55 * and `ucontext_t` (for processor registers).
57 * It works with the `s_mc_unw_context_t` context.
59 extern XBT_PRIVATE unw_accessors_t mc_unw_accessors;
